Early Life and Education
Born as Aahoo Jahansouzshahi in Euless, Texas, Sarah Shahi comes from a multicultural family with Iranian and Spanish heritage. Her father emigrated from Iran before the Iranian Revolution, while her mother has Iranian and Spanish ancestry. Growing up, she was encouraged to participate in beauty pageants and sports, developing confidence from an early age. Because classmates struggled with her birth name, she adopted “Sarah” during elementary school, a decision that stayed with her throughout her career.
Shahi attended Trinity High School, where she excelled in athletics before enrolling at Southern Methodist University. She studied English and theater but left college before graduating after receiving an opportunity that would unexpectedly shape her career. Before entering Hollywood, she became a member of the Dallas Cowboys Cheerleaders, gaining national exposure and valuable performance experience.
How Sarah Shahi Started Her Acting Career
Sarah Shahi’s transition into acting happened after she moved to Los Angeles while working as a professional cheerleader. She began with guest appearances in television shows before gradually earning larger roles. Like many actors starting in Hollywood, she spent several years building experience through supporting characters rather than leading roles.
Her appearances in series such as Alias, Dawson’s Creek, Supernatural, and The Sopranos introduced audiences to her versatility. Casting directors quickly recognized her ability to portray confident, emotionally layered characters, opening the door to more substantial television opportunities.
Breakthrough Roles That Made Sarah Shahi Famous
The L Word
One of Shahi’s first major breakthroughs came with Showtime’s The L Word, where she portrayed Carmen de la Pica Morales. The role significantly expanded her visibility and remains one of her most recognizable performances.
Life
She later starred as Detective Dani Reese in NBC’s crime drama Life. Her chemistry with Damian Lewis and her believable portrayal of a detective helped establish her as a serious dramatic actress capable of leading complex television narratives.
Fairly Legal
In USA Network’s Fairly Legal, Shahi took on the lead role of Kate Reed, a legal mediator known for resolving disputes outside traditional courtrooms. The series highlighted her ability to carry an entire television show while balancing humor and drama.
Sarah Shahi in Person of Interest
Many fans consider Sameen Shaw from Person of Interest to be Sarah Shahi’s defining television role. Introduced during the second season, Shaw is a former government operative with exceptional combat skills and a unique emotional profile.
Her performance received praise for portraying a highly intelligent yet emotionally reserved character without relying on stereotypes. Shaw quickly became one of the series’ most popular characters, with audiences appreciating both her action sequences and subtle character development. The role remains a favorite among science fiction and crime drama fans years after the show’s conclusion.
Netflix Success with Sex/Life
Sarah Shahi reached a much broader global audience through Netflix’s Sex/Life. She portrayed Billie Connelly, a suburban wife navigating the tension between family responsibilities and personal desires.
The series became one of Netflix’s most talked-about original dramas, introducing Shahi to millions of international viewers. Her emotionally vulnerable performance earned widespread attention and sparked conversations about relationships, identity, and personal fulfillment. Although the series concluded after two seasons, it significantly elevated her international profile.

Personal Life
Sarah Shahi married actor Steve Howey in 2009, and the couple welcomed three children together before divorcing in 2021. They have publicly maintained a cooperative co-parenting relationship focused on their children.
Following her work on Sex/Life, Shahi began a relationship with co-star Adam Demos. In early 2026, she confirmed that the couple had ended their relationship after several years together while emphasizing personal growth and moving forward positively.
Recent Career and Latest Updates
Sarah Shahi continues to expand her career beyond acting. She stars as Dr. Gabriela Torabi in Hulu’s political thriller Paradise, further demonstrating her range in dramatic television.
In 2026, she also released Life Is Lifey: The A to Z’s on Navigating Life’s Messy Middle, a memoir and self-development book that combines personal stories with practical life lessons. During interviews promoting the book, Shahi discussed overcoming childhood trauma, resilience, and personal transformation, topics that resonated strongly with readers.
